-#ifndef BOOST_TT_IS_LVALUE_REFERENCE_HPP_INCLUDED
-#define BOOST_TT_IS_LVALUE_REFERENCE_HPP_INCLUDED
-
-#include <cutl/details/boost/type_traits/config.hpp>
-
-#ifdef BOOST_NO_TEMPLATE_PARTIAL_SPECIALIZATION
-# include <cutl/details/boost/type_traits/detail/yes_no_type.hpp>
-# include <cutl/details/boost/type_traits/detail/wrap.hpp>
-#endif
-
-// should be the last #include
-#include <cutl/details/boost/type_traits/detail/bool_trait_def.hpp>
-
-namespace cutl_details_boost {
-
-#if defined( __CODEGEARC__ )
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_DEF1(is_lvalue_reference,T,__is_reference(T))
-#elif !defined(BOOST_NO_TEMPLATE_PARTIAL_SPECIALIZATION)
-
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_DEF1(is_lvalue_reference,T,false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T&,true)
-
-#if defined(BOOST_ILLEGAL_CV_REFERENCES)
-// these are illegal specialisations; cv-qualifies applied to
-// references have no effect according to [8.3.2p1],
-// C++ Builder requires them though as it treats cv-qualified
-// references as distinct types...
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T& const,true)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T& volatile,true)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T& const volatile,true)
-#endif
-
-#if defined(__GNUC__) && (__GNUC__ < 3)
-// these allow us to work around illegally cv-qualified reference
-// types.
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T const ,::cutl_details_boost::is_lvalue_reference<T>::value)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T volatile ,::cutl_details_boost::is_lvalue_reference<T>::value)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_1(typename T,is_lvalue_reference,T const volatile ,::cutl_details_boost::is_lvalue_reference<T>::value)
-// However, the above specializations confuse gcc 2.96 unless we also
-// supply these specializations for array types
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_2(typename T,unsigned long N,is_lvalue_reference,T[N],false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_2(typename T,unsigned long N,is_lvalue_reference,const T[N],false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_2(typename T,unsigned long N,is_lvalue_reference,volatile T[N],false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_PARTIAL_SPEC1_2(typename T,unsigned long N,is_lvalue_reference,const volatile T[N],false)
-#endif
-
-#else
-
-#ifdef BOOST_MSVC
-# pragma warning(push)
-# pragma warning(disable: 4181 4097)
-#endif
-
-namespace detail {
-
-using ::cutl_details_boost::type_traits::yes_type;
-using ::cutl_details_boost::type_traits::no_type;
-using ::cutl_details_boost::type_traits::wrap;
-
-template <class T> T&(* is_lvalue_reference_helper1(wrap<T>) )(wrap<T>);
-char is_lvalue_reference_helper1(...);
-
-template <class T> no_type is_lvalue_reference_helper2(T&(*)(wrap<T>));
-yes_type is_lvalue_reference_helper2(...);
-
-template <typename T>
-struct is_lvalue_reference_impl
-{
- B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(
- bool, value = sizeof(
- ::cutl_details_boost::detail::is_lvalue_reference_helper2(
- ::cutl_details_boost::detail::is_lvalue_reference_helper1(::cutl_details_boost::type_traits::wrap<T>()))) == 1
- );
-};
-
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_IMPL_SPEC1(is_lvalue_reference,void,false)
-#ifndef BOOST_NO_CV_VOID_SPECIALIZATIONS
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_IMPL_SPEC1(is_lvalue_reference,void const,false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_IMPL_SPEC1(is_lvalue_reference,void volatile,false)
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_IMPL_SPEC1(is_lvalue_reference,void const volatile,false)
-#endif
-
-} // namespace detail
-
-BOOST_TT_AUX_BOOL_TRAIT_DEF1(is_lvalue_reference,T,::cutl_details_boost::detail::is_lvalue_reference_impl<T>::value)
-
-#ifdef BOOST_MSVC
-# pragma warning(pop)
-#endif
-
-#endif // BOOST_NO_TEMPLATE_PARTIAL_SPECIALIZATION
-
-} // namespace cutl_details_boost
-
-#include <cutl/details/boost/type_traits/detail/bool_trait_undef.hpp>
-
-#endif // BOOST_TT_IS_REFERENCE_HPP_INCLUDED
